A Boeing employee buys a ticket to a $747 million jackpot – and wins

The last Boeing 747 was delivered in early February. Now the plane has given a longtime Boeing employee three-quarters of a billion dollars.

  • Becky Bell has worked at Boeing Airplanes for more than three decades.

  • The mother-of-three won the $747 million grand prize with the delivery of the last Boeing 747.

  • After the final settlement, she won a total of $754.6 million.

A Boeing employee announced the end of production of jumbo jets Win a million dollar lottery granted. The state lottery company said in a statement Friday that it had already purchased its regular lottery ticket when it saw while shopping over a weekend in early February that the Powerball lottery jackpot had grown to $747 million. Normally, you only spend $20 a week on the lottery. But this was a sign, because only a few days before her employer received the 1574th position and The last Boeing 747 has been delivered.

36 years old at Boeing

“I had to buy another ticket,” said Becky Bell, who has worked for Boeing in Auburn, Washington, for nearly 36 years. Inspiration turned out to be a huge success. According to the lottery, Bill hit the fifth largest jackpot in Powerball history, winning not only $747, but even $754.6 million (about 710 million euros). “I have never won more than $20 in my life. You can imagine how dumbfounded I was,” she said.

“No, mom, seven million dollars.”

According to the Washington lottery portal, the mother of three woke her son up first to check the numbers. Then she asked her two daughters to check the winning numbers. Sure enough, she sent the photo of the winning ticket to her mom and sisters.

“The funny thing is, when I told her how much I had earned, my mom misunderstood me,” Bell said. “Seven million, she said… That’s great, honey. Anyone can have a million.” Then Bill said, “No, Mom, seven million dollars.” Then everyone started crying.
